Kishenji aide surrenders with wife

Midnapore (WB), Feb 7,2012, (PTI)

Maoist area commander Chiranjit Mahto, an associate of slain top Maoist leader Kishenji, and his wife, also a Maoist cadre, today surrendered before the police here today.

Chiranjit, who was the Kantapahari area commander, was a close aide of Maoist politburo member Kishenji, the third in-command of the CPI(Maoist), who was gunned down in an encounter on November 24 in a forest in the district, the police said.

Chiranjit's wife Anima Mahto was a member of the Badal Mahto squad.

The couple, who surrendered before IG (South Bengal) Gangeswar Singh, DIG (Midnapore range) Vineet Goel and district SP Praveen Tripathy, did not lay down any arms, police said.

The two faced altogether eight cases against them in Salbani and Lalgarh police stations, sources said.

Stating that the arrest of Chiranjit was a big success, Tripathy said the couple would get government assistance as per rule.
